How To Contact An Inmate At Youngs Jail
Mail Inmates
You can mail inmates at the Youngs Jail addressed to:
Inmate ID, Inmate Name, Youngs Jail, 116 West Boardman St, Youngstown, OH 44503. Please note that all incoming mail is subject to inspection for security reasons. Do not include any items considered contraband or contain explicit material in the mail. Additionally, make sure to include a return address.Connect Inmates Via Phone
The Youngs Jail allows phone calls or video communication with offenders. Phone calls get managed through GTL, which requires setting up a specific account. Read our first-time phone setup guide for a hassle-free experience. It's important to note that all calls are recorded and subject to monitoring. Inmates are unable to receive calls but can make collect calls.
How to Send Money To An Inmate's Trust Fund In Youngs Jail
Sending money to an inmate's trust fund has become much easier in the last ten years. To send money to an inmate incarcerated in Youngs Jail, you can use any of the following methods:
- Using the Jpay.com website or Mobile Apps Jpay Android / Jpay iOS
- Using Phone: Call the 24/7 helpline 800-574-5729, speak with a live agent to send money.
- You can also use kiosks by Jpay.

Prepare For Visitation
Visitation Rules
All visitors must produce an I.D. during the visit. Follow the below rules during visitation for a hassle-free experience:
- If you are a convicted felon or have a warrant on your name, your visit will be dis-approved
- You will be dis-approved for visiting if you are on active probation, parole, or any form of conditional release.
- Don't wear revealing / improper attire.
- Don't be under the influence of alcohol and drugs.
- Ex-inmates are not allowed to visit the facility
- Don't threaten any person in custody or the jail's security.
